J. Crew Niagara Falls - Hours & Locations
J. Crew - Niagara Falls
1808 Military Rd, Niagara Falls NY 14304 Phone Number:(716) 297-2474Hours may fluctuate
Distance:4.12 miles
J. Crew - Buffalo
1 Walden Galleria, Buffalo NY 14225 Phone Number:(716) 684-8189Hours may fluctuate
Distance:19.53 miles